Power Methodology and Modeling Engineer – New College Grad 2026

Published Date: January 29, 2026
NVIDIA, Austin, TX 78701
Job Description:

Join NVIDIA's Architecture Energy Modeling Team to collaborate with various engineering teams in studying and implementing energy modeling techniques for next-generation GPUs, CPUs, and Tegra SOCs. Your work will focus on understanding energy usage in graphics and AI workloads, contributing to improvements in architecture, design, and power management.

Responsibilities:

  • Define and implement tools and methodologies for efficient data generation from post layout netlists for power analytical models.
  • Develop tools and infrastructure to sanitize metrics for high correlation accuracy.
  • Integrate power models with performance tools efficiently.
  • Identify runtime and memory limitations in existing flows to expedite model delivery.
  • Analyze pre- and post-silicon performance data to identify bottlenecks and provide feedback for power efficiency improvements.
  • Collaborate with various teams to integrate data movement power models.
  • Experiment with ML techniques to set power/energy targets for next-gen chips.
  • Enable efficient data storage and retrieval from databases.
  • Facilitate data visualization using platforms like PowerBI and OpenSearch.

Qualifications:

  • Pursuing or recently completed a BS, MS, or PhD in Electrical or Computer Engineering or equivalent experience.
  • Strong coding skills, preferably in Python or C++.
  • Ability to analyze algorithms and their runtime and memory complexities.
  • Understanding of VLSI, digital design, and computer architecture concepts.
  • Basic knowledge of power and energy consumption estimation and low power design.
  • Familiarity with the chip design process from RTL design to tape-out.
  • Background in machine learning, AI, or statistical modeling is a plus.

Skills:

  • Quantitative decision-making and analytics for energy efficiency improvement.
  • Strong problem-solving and analytical skills.
  • Collaboration and communication skills to work with diverse teams.
